Understanding Gold IRAs
A Gold IRA is a sort of self-directed individual retirement account that allows buyers to carry physical gold and different precious metals as a part of their retirement savings. Not like traditional IRAs, which usually consist of stocks, bonds, and mutual funds, Gold IRAs present an alternative asset class that can hedge towards economic downturns and inflation.
To determine a Gold IRA, buyers should work with a custodian who focuses on treasured metals. The custodian is answerable for the storage, administration, and compliance of the account. Investors can purchase gold coins, bars, and bullion, offered they meet specific purity and quality standards set by the internal Income Service (IRS).

Potential Drawbacks of Gold IRAs
- Storage and Insurance Prices: One in all the numerous downsides of Gold IRAs is the cost related to storage and insurance coverage. Bodily gold should be stored in an IRS-authorised depository, which incurs annual charges. Additionally, traders might wish to insure their holdings, including additional costs.
- Restricted Liquidity: While gold might be sold comparatively simply, changing it to money might not be as straightforward as selling stocks or bonds. Buyers may face delays in promoting their gold, especially if market circumstances are unfavorable.
- Market Volatility: Although gold is commonly seen as a stable investment, it is not immune to price fluctuations. Gold prices will be affected by various elements, together with geopolitical tensions, forex strength, and adjustments in curiosity rates. Traders must be prepared for potential volatility of their gold investments.
- No Revenue Technology: Unlike dividend-paying stocks or curiosity-bearing bonds, gold does not generate any revenue. This can be an obstacle for traders seeking common money circulate from their retirement accounts.
- Regulatory Restrictions: Gold IRAs are subject to particular IRS laws, together with guidelines about the varieties of gold that may be held within the account. Buyers should be certain that their holdings comply with these laws to avoid penalties.
